This week was focused on the creative process, beginning to plan our major projects, and working on a concept statement, focusing on thinking and planning.

I plan to engage with the concept of documentary landscape photography and also tie in some elements of popular culture.

Popular culture can be defined as “the set of practices, beliefs, and objects
that embody the most broadly shared meanings of a social system.” This will be relevant to my images, as they will be locations that carry the same feeling of memories and nostalgia to those in my local area.

I decided that my project will be based on local nostalgia, and I am going to capture local places that hold significance to me and my childhood, as well as others who have grown up in my area.
